rex [field=] (.+)\." The extraction rule application generates extraction rules based on the event records and the field data. Some cookies may continue to collect information after you have left our website. All info submitted will be anonymized. edited Nov 15, '16 by gokadroid 5.8k 0 Votes 2 Answers 564 Views Splunk Add-on for Cisco WSA: How to extract the user from Cisco WSA logs? answered Jan 24, '19 by premraj_vs 24 0 Votes 3 Answers 1.5k Views How do add a field … We'd love to hear from you in our 10-minute Splunk Career Impact survey! It matches a regular expression pattern in each event, and saves the value in a field that you specify. You can use the field extractor to generate field-extracting … Anything here will not be captured and stored into the variable. Start studying splunk exam 2. You can disable key cleaning for a search-time field extraction by configuring it as an advanced REPORT- extraction type, including the setting CLEAN_KEYS=false in the referenced field transform stanza. Splunk, Splunk>, Turn Data Into Doing, Data-to-Everything and D2E are trademarks or registered trademarks of Splunk Inc. in the United States and other countries. Always follow this format to configure transforms.conf [] REGEX = FORMAT = =$1 =$2 DEST_KEY = Example, You should be able to limit your searches by simply adding a the field = value as part of your search terms. Video Walk-through of this app! Regular Expressions are useful in multiple areas: search commands regex and rex; eval functions match() and replace(); and in field extraction. How to write the regular expression to extract this field with rex. All we do is specify the regular expression to pattern-match the call duration number (in this case it’s “92” in our event) and name it as “callDuration”. Splunk software applies key cleaning to fields that are extracted at search time. In these cases, Field extraction at index-time makes our job easy. The regex can no longer be edited. splunk-enterprise regex rex props.conf search regular-expression transforms.conf json xml extracted-fields csv field sourcetype multivalue field-extract timestamp fields splunk-cloud extracted-field eval search-time index-time table The regular expression method works best with unstructured event data. left side of The left side of what you want stored as a variable. This is a Splunk extracted field. A. All other brand Can someone please help? 1.4k. Splunk offers a visual aide called the field extractor which can offer two field extraction methods: regular expression and delimiters. consider posting a question to Splunkbase Answers. B. Now, notice that in the extraction of the call duration field in our example cdr_log sourcetype above uses the new EXTRACT option in props.conf to explicitly pull out and name the field we want. However I am struggling to extract. You must be logged into splunk.com in order to post comments. Without writing any regex, we are able to use Splunk to figure out the field extraction for us. 0. Rather than learning the “ins and outs” of Regex, Splunk provides the erex command, which I've got tens of regular expressions working as field extractions, I've got this particular expression working in search and in a python script, I'm just really out of ideas as to why it's not working in the field extraction. field extractions and the field extractor (Splunk) Splunk offers a visual aide called the field extractor which can offer two field extraction methods: regular expression and delimiters. Manage knowledge objects through Settings pages, Give knowledge objects of the same type unique names, Develop naming conventions for knowledge objects, Understand and use the Common Information Model Add-on, Build field extractions with the field extractor, Configure advanced extractions with field transforms, Configure automatic key-value field extraction, Example inline field extraction configurations, Example transform field extraction configurations, Configure extractions of multivalue fields with fields.conf, Configure calculated fields with props.conf, Add field matching rules to your lookup configuration, Control workflow action appearance in field and event menus, Use special parameters in workflow actions, Define initial data for a new table dataset, Overview of summary-based search acceleration, Share data model acceleration summaries among search heads, Use summary indexing for increased search efficiency, Design searches that populate summary events indexes. 0. A report can be created using this custom field. Learn how to use Splunk, from beginner basics to advanced techniques, with … This means that you can apply one regular expression to multiple field extraction configurations, or multiple regular expressions to one field extraction configuration. edited Jan 13, '20 by leifab 22. The capturing groups in your regular expression must identify field names that contain alpha-numeric characters or an underscore. Answer. The field being extracted will be required for all Views. INDEX TIME FIELD EXTRACTION USING WRITE_META. For inline extraction types, Splunk Web displays the regular expression that Splunk software uses to extract the field. The Field Extractor (FX) is used to extract a custom field. Here is the best part: When you click on “Job” (just above the Timeline), you can see the actual regular expression that Get fast answers and downloadable apps for Splunk, the IT Search solution for Log Management, Operations, Security, and Compliance. I have fields in the format of LOG_ID, DEVICE_DATA, USERNAME, that I'd like to extract, and I'd like to exclude the default Splunk fields like _time, *_raw, and timeendpos, timestartpos, etc. The named group (or groups) within the regex show you what field(s) it extracts. This happens when you enter the field extractor: After you run a search where a specific source type is identified in the search string and then click the Extract New Fields link in the fields sidebar or the All Fields dialog box. Usage of Splunk commands : REGEX is as follows Regex command removes those results which don’t match with the specified regular expression. Learn vocabulary, terms, and more with flashcards, games, and other study tools. 1. The field being extracted will be required for all About regular expressions with field extractions. The topic did not answer my question(s) Enter your email address, and someone from the documentation team will respond to you: Please provide your comments here. Teams Q&A for Work Stack Overflow for Teams is a private, secure spot for you and your coworkers to find and share information. # vi transforms.conf. Is there a way to use the lookup to make my rex command regular expression dynamic so I only extract the fields I am interested in? Key cleaning is enabled by default. Regular expressions. An example would be LOG_ID=12312 DEVICE_DATA="random stuff" USERNAME="DAVIDTEST". Splunk Field Extraction Regex. Yes Including/excluding fields is done using the fields command. The rex command is used for extracting fields out of events though. How can i change the name ACTIVITY into a proper regular expression to get bytes read 0 written 317555 when i enter a field I have a query in which i want to add a regular expression where it can display the events with bytes read 0 written 317555. I want to extract a field in splunk however Splunk Regex won't work so I am writing my own Regex. Votes. _raw. Many Splunk users have found the benefit of implementing Regex for field extraction, masking values, and the ability to narrow results. What is the regex that Splunk uses? 233. You should be able to limit your searches by simply adding a the field = value as part of your search terms. Answers. When performing a regular expression (regex) field extraction using the Field Extractor (FX), what happens when the require option is used? Index Time Field Extraction : Before index the data, we have to change the following files. By the Interactive Field Extractor you can do it very easily. Splunk Knowledge Objects — Edureka In this article, I am going to explain the following concept — Splunk lookup, fields and field extraction. You'll probably want to do your own field extraction since your data will not be exactly like the example you added. When performing a regular expression (regex) field extraction using the Field Extractor (FX), what happens when the require option is used? 2. Just enter your search terms, followed by | rex "your regular expression field extraction". The Field Extractor (FX) is used to extract a custom field. INDEX TIME FIELD EXTRACTION USING WRITE_META In this post we decided to cover a very common but little tricky Splunk configuration, implementing index time field extraction . For any further references, it is very much required for you to access the official Splunk documentation or the cheat sheet that they provide for regular expressions as such. Appearently it is hard to find a regular expression for this case (even the question is if it is possible at all). For information on the field extractor, see Build field extractions with the field extractor. The source to apply the regular expression to. The regex can no longer be edited. You can test your regular expression by using the rex search command. © 2021 Splunk Inc. All rights reserved. Extract Fields Using Regular Expressions at Search Time | windbag | rex field=sample "^(?[\S+]*)" Named Field Extraction Grab any non-space character. (Example: "LOG_ID=12312") commented Sep 24, '18 by Kawtar 20. How to extract particular field at index time and search time. Answer. If we don’t specify any field with the regex command then by default I generated the regular expression using the field extractor, which is pretty intuitive. How to edit my regular expression for a multivalue field extraction with new lines? Search commands that use regular expressions include rex and regex and evaluation functions such as match and replace. This has been carefully compiled with all the necessary functions being considered, hence you can use it without any doubts. (C:Program FilesSplunketcsystemlocal) 1. transforms.conf [< unique_transform_stanza_name >] REGEX = < regular_expression > FORMAT […] If so, what exactly were your expressions? splunk-enterprise field-extraction rex regular-expression extracted-field. This field extraction stanza, created in props.conf , references both of the field transforms: Everything here is still a regular expression. Splunk, Splunk>, Turn Data Into Doing, Data-to-Everything, and D2E are trademarks or Highlight some text and Splunk will automatically learn to extract your fields! Splunkで正規表現を使って検索する方法をご紹介します。 大体以下のコマンドを使うことになると思います。 1. regexコマンド フィルタのみ行いたい場合 1. rexコマンド マッチした値をフィールド値として保持したい場合 1. erexコマンド 正規表現がわからない場合 # regexコマンド 正規表現 … If you have a more general question about Splunk functionality or are experiencing a difficulty with Splunk, Many Splunk users have found the benefit of implementing Regex for field extraction, masking values, and the ability to narrow results. Inline and transform field extractions require regular expressions with the names of the fields that they extract. Auto-suggest helps you quickly narrow down your search results by suggesting possible matches as you type. So without writing regular expression you can easily extract fields from your data. keywords: regex, regexes, regular expression, regular expressions, pcre, fields, field extraction, machine learning, ai. See Configure inline extractions with props.conf. You also use regular expressions when you define custom field extractions, filter events, route data, and correlate searches. Example: Log bla message=hello world next=some-value bla Since Splunk uses a space to determine the next field to start this is quite a challenge. We’ll do this at searchtime to allow the definition of these extracted fields to be dynamic. | rex field= _raw - > this is how you specify you are starting a regular expression on the raw event in Splunk. I am considering extracting the field (message ID) using the rex command, but I can not extract it with regular expressions. Although, it’s almost always better to prefer “ search-time extraction ” over “ index-time extraction ”. Splunk regular expressions are PCRE (Perl Compatible Regular Expressions) and use the PCRE C library. Usage of Splunk commands : REGEX is as follows . Today, In this article we will learn how to extract fields at index-time. We also use these cookies to improve our products and services, support our marketing campaigns, and advertise to you on our website and other websites. Other. Not bad at all. Log in now. ! You can use the field extractor to generate field-extracting regular expressions. You cannot turn off key cleaning for inline EXTRACT- (props.conf only) field extraction configurations. | rex field= _raw - > this is how you specify you are starting a regular expression on the raw event in Splunk. In transform extractions, the regular expression is separated from the field extraction configuration. If you have "key=value" pairs, Splunk should be extracting them as a field by the name of "key" and the corresponding value "value". Field extractions are covered here: http://docs.splunk.com/Documentation/Splunk/latest/Knowledge/Addfieldsatsearchtime, And there's an excellent Splunk tutorial: http://docs.splunk.com/Documentation/Splunk/latest/Tutorial/WelcometotheSplunkTutorial. http://docs.splunk.com/Documentation/Splunk/latest/Knowledge/Addfieldsatsearchtime, http://docs.splunk.com/Documentation/Splunk/latest/Tutorial/WelcometotheSplunkTutorial. I'd recommend testing your field extractions using the rex command in a search before adding them to the extractions page. Views. 1. We all know that for writing any SPL query we need some fields. Although, it’s almost always better to prefer “ search-time extraction ” over “ index-time extraction ”. Ideally, you'll just need torex The Splunk field extractor is limited to twenty lines on a sample event. If so, what exactly were your expressions? Votes. The following article should be your one-stop-shop for all the regular expressions that you would use in Splunk software for any purpose, be it for your evaluation or even to perform any search related operations. If the field extraction in the GUi didn't work for you, did you try six different regular expressions using the rex command? This setting in FORMAT enables Splunk Enterprise to keep matching the regular expression against a matching event until every matching field/value combination is extracted. rex Command Use Rex to Perform SED Style Substitutions SED is a stream editor. Interactive Field Extractor ( IFX ) in Splunk. Question by arpitpropay Mar 09 at 08:58 AM 22 1 1 5. Preview regular expression field representation When you click Preview after defining one or more field extraction fields, Splunk software runs the regular expression against the datasets in your dataset that have the Extract From It increases our search performance as well. Has your Splunk expertise, certifications, and general awesomeness impacted your career? dos!!!!!?!!!! Learn vocabulary, terms, and more with flashcards, games, and other study tools. Regex in Splunk SPL “A regular expression is an object that describes a pattern of characters. Closing this box indicates that you accept our Cookie Policy. You can use regular expressions with inline field extractions to apply your inline field extraction … keywords: regex, regexes, regular expression, regular expressions, pcre, fields, field extraction, machine learning, ai Field Extractor and Anonymizer Teach Splunk to automatically extract fields from your data, by just highlighting text! If you want to learn more info you can go through this blog Splunk Regex Cheatsheet. The regular expression is in transforms.conf while the field extraction is in props.conf. Field Extraction on-the-fly What’s in it for me? © 2005-2020 Splunk Inc. All rights reserved. I want to extract a character string using a regular expression. I did not like the topic organization In inline field extractions, the regular expression is in props.conf. Depending upon field values we usually segregate data as per our requirement. You can design them so that they extract two or more fields from the events that match them. Please select Ask a question or make a suggestion. Can you update the quesiton with a specific example of the line you're extracting this data from? Regex%vs%Restof%the%(paern)%World% %%%%%anyanyamountof’ characteranycharacterExamples! How to use the same field name here?My basic aim to have a single regex for all log patterns mentioned. Teams Q&A for Work Stack Overflow for Teams is a private, secure spot for you and your coworkers to find and share information. Field names must conform to the field name syntax rules. for each event it indexes. You have one regular expression per field extraction configuration. This documentation applies to the following versions of Splunk® Enterprise: Syntax for the command: | rex field=field_to_rex_from “FrontAnchor(?{characters}+)BackAnchor” Let’s take a look at an example. bash! If we don’t specify any field with the regex command then by default the regular expression applied on the _raw field. rex is a SPL (Search Processing Language) command that extracts fields from the raw data based on the pattern you specify using regular expressions. Explorer ‎07 ... (?J) option but splunk recognizes them as different fields. Jun 20, 2020 in Splunk by Lakshmi . 0 Karma Reply. Votes. How do you write a regular expression to extract a field between two colons with a particular pattern? Teach Splunk to automatically extract fields from your data, by just highlighting text! 7.0.0, 7.0.1, 7.0.2, 7.0.3, 7.0.4, 7.0.5, 7.0.6, 7.0.7, 7.0.8, 7.0.9, 7.0.10, 7.0.11, 7.0.13, 7.1.0, 7.1.1, 7.1.2, 7.1.3, 7.1.4, 7.1.5, 7.1.6, 7.1.7, 7.1.8, 7.1.9, 7.1.10, 7.2.0, 7.2.1, 7.2.2, 7.2.3, 7.2.4, 7.2.5, 7.2.6, 7.2.7, 7.2.8, 7.2.9, 7.2.10, 7.3.0, 7.3.1, 7.3.2, 7.3.3, 7.3.4, 7.3.5, 7.3.6, 7.3.7, 7.3.8, 8.0.0, 8.0.1, 8.0.2, 8.0.3, 8.0.4, 8.0.5, 8.0.6, 8.0.7, 8.0.8, 8.1.0, 8.1.1, Was this documentation topic helpful? You can design them so that they extract two or more fields from the events that match them. registered trademarks of Splunk Inc. in the United States and other countries. Note that it does not include grok pattern creation, however, Elastic’s dissect filter does implement delimiters. (Example: "LOG_ID=12312"). An extraction rule application receives field data describing the fields to be extracted (including one or more examples) and a collection of event records that may be a representative sample set from a larger set of events records. A. Views. No, the regex command is used for filtering search results based on a regular expression. How to develop a regular expression to use with a field extraction? Learn more If you are interested in displaying only certain fields in a table format, then piping into a table command and listing the fields you want is enough. The command takes search results as input (i.e the command is written after a pipe in SPL). We use our own and third-party cookies to provide you with a great online experience. When using regular expression in Splunk, use the rex command to either extract fields using regular expression-named groups or replace or substitute characters in a field using those expressions. Please select 0. Create advanced search-time field extractions with field transforms, Configure inline extractions with props.conf, Learn more (including how to update your settings) here ». Splunk offers two commands (rex and regex) in SPL that allow Splunk analysts to utilize regular expressions in order to assign values to new fields or narrow results on the fly as part of their search. The capturing groups in your regular expression must identify field names that contain alpha-numeric characters or an underscore. Which is pretty intuitive decided to cover a very common but little tricky Splunk configuration implementing! Regular expression using the custom field in the fields can contain anything, I... Fields that they extract with new lines and other study tools field extractions, the regex command (... And transform field extractions, the regex command from your data that match them auto-suggest helps quickly! The content covered in this documentation topic field values we usually segregate as! I am writing my own regex extractor which can offer two field extraction methods: regular expression the... Twenty lines on a regular expression that Splunk software applies key cleaning is,... That Splunk software uses to extract a custom field regex for all log patterns mentioned results as (! Fix my field extraction methods: regular expression field extraction, masking values, and more with flashcards,,., terms, followed by | rex field= _raw - > this is how you specify product,... Require regular expressions the fields can contain anything, so I am writing my own regex cases field. Write regular expressions with the field ( s ) it extracts extraction using regular expression method works best with event! Index the data, and correlate searches collect information after you have one expression. Side of what you want stored as a variable and third-party cookies provide. You write a regular expression pattern in each event, and Compliance in your regular expression field page... Have a single regex for field extraction configurations can apply one regular expression is an object that describes a of! For log Management, Operations, Security, and someone from the data, are! To be dynamic extract two or more fields from the documentation team respond... Spl query we need some fields regex, regexes, regular expressions PCRE! Comments here message ID ) using the rex search command writing regular expression is separated from the data in GUi..., ai what field ( message ID ) using the rex command is used to extract a field two! Saves the value in a field in Splunk however Splunk regex Cheatsheet my own regex are to. Extraction types, Splunk Enterprise to keep this discussion focused on the raw event in Splunk functions... An object that describes a pattern of characters it extracts you should be able to limit searches. Have found the benefit of implementing regex for all splunk regular expression field extraction patterns mentioned generate field-extracting regular expressions providing! You 're extracting this data from those results which don ’ t any! That use regular expressions are ( PCRE ) Perl Compatible regular expressions when you define custom field the. Am considering extracting the field extractor which can offer two field extraction expression is in props.conf the. See Create advanced search-time field extractions, the regular expression per field extraction for us a very but! Name syntax rules and replace also utilise the PCRE C library. an example would LOG_ID=12312... Matching the regular expression is an object that describes a pattern of characters followed by | rex `` your expression! Your email address, and Compliance within the regex command is written after a pipe in ). Regex ” in Splunk however Splunk regex wo n't work for you, did try... Arpitpropay Mar 09 at 08:58 am 22 1 1 5 Perform SED Style Substitutions SED is a editor! Configuration files, you must be logged into splunk.com in order to post comments extracting this data?. Extractions are covered here: http: //docs.splunk.com/Documentation/Splunk/latest/Tutorial/WelcometotheSplunkTutorial splunk regular expression field extraction suggesting possible matches as you..

What Is A Charter Fishing Boat, Cartoons In 2004, Surjivan Resort Reviews, Fiction Books About Jewelry, What Is Part Of The Integumentary System, Nijamena Song Lyrics In Telugu, Polaris Prize Shortlist, Tokyo Deli Elsternwick Menu, Mouse Miraculous Transformation, Madam Red Death Episode, Tyler, The Creator - Yonkers Meaning, Osage Beach Condos For Sale By Owner, Homes Made Of Concrete For Sale, Pokemon Y In-game Trades,